Rust is the iron in steel oxidizing. Aluminum oxidizes too, but unlike steel/iron, it’s oxide is (most of the time) a protective layer rather than one that will ultimately destroy the material.

 

To the OPs issue. That looks like the front of the bar. Right behind the front tire is a pretty tough spot for anything to survive with everything being thrown up from the road. You could try to get the dealer to do something under warranty but I’m not sure how that will go.

If you bought them and installed yourself, 1 year part warranty from GM.  If they were factory or dealer installed at the time of buying the truck, covered under bumper to bumper 3/36 warranty.
